This special topic volume on “Photocatalytic Materials and Surfaces for Environmental Cleanup IV” addresses photocatalysis in wide sense focus on the environmental applications of photocatalytic materials. Photocatalytic materials had been widely studied for the various applications such as water and air purification, CO2 reduction, hydrogen generation, and development of auto-cleaning surfaces etc. The present special topic volume covers the application of various photocatalytic materials for CO2 reduction, hydrogen generation, removal of pesticides, degradation of organic pollutant and recent development in the fabrication of photocatalytic reactors.
